Superhuman features and specs

  • Speed
    Superhuman is designed for speed, with shortcuts and streamlined workflows that allow users to process emails extremely quickly.
  • User Interface
    The user interface is clean, minimalistic, and intuitive, which enhances user experience and efficiency.
  • Advanced Features
    Superhuman offers advanced features such as AI-powered triage, read status tracking, and undo send, which add significant value.
  • Focus
    The app emphasizes focus by providing distraction-free email management, reducing interruptions and helping users maintain concentration.
  • Customer Support
    The company provides strong customer support, including personalized onboarding which ensures users can effectively utilize the app.

Possible disadvantages of Superhuman

  • Cost
    Superhuman is relatively expensive compared to other email clients, making it less accessible for budget-conscious users.
  • Exclusivity
    Currently, Superhuman is only available through an invitation model, which can make it hard for interested users to gain access.
  • Limited Platforms
    Superhuman is limited to specific platforms like macOS and iOS, which can be a drawback for users on other operating systems.
  • Learning Curve
    The app has a significant learning curve, especially related to mastering the many keyboard shortcuts required for optimal use.
  • Privacy Concerns
    Some users have raised concerns about data privacy and the extent of tracking Superhuman performs, which could be a deterrent for privacy-conscious individuals.

Superhuman vs. Gmail: A Tale of Two Email Experiences
It's important to note that Superhuman doesn't offer a free version or trial, which could be a drawback for those who prefer to test a service before committing to a subscription. However, Superhuman does provide a 14-day, money-back guarantee, allowing users to explore the the email software platform's capabilities and determine if it aligns with their email management...
